Lately I have been obssessed with both the book and the movie "Atonement" my Ian McEwan. That Brit can write! Plus, I am a sucker for women with British accents, and Keira Knightly is easy on the eyes, and the movie is just a blast to watch. (Sorry Sarah Garcia...I actually like her mouth, especially when she smokes) The book also builds suspense just as well and I think it is remarkable how each can stand alone and each works well for totally different reasons. That is rare for the whole book/movie thing.
Also, there is history in it. One thing I can't stand. Briony. She is the antagonist (I think, English majors, help me out here). Ugh! I want to slap her, and I am not a very violent person. It brings up the most important question of all. Why can't others be happy for others who are in love? Why can't we just support other people's love, even though it might sink like the Titanic and crash into a million tiny pieces? Didn't Shakesphere (or some other dead English guy) say "it is is better to love and lost than never to have loved at all?" (Remember folks I quit English for History) I for one love to support others in their love, even if I don't think they have a chance in Hell. Why? I am not sure. Maybe its in the hope that others will support me in the same way, even when I don't know what I am doing.
